TotalEnergies has begun construction on a 440 MWp solar power plant in Ilagan City, Philippines, with a $300 million investment. The project, owned 65% by TotalEnergies and 35% by Nextnorth, is expected to generate 13.5 TWh over 20 years. More than half of the output is contracted for commercial and industrial use, while the rest will be sold to the grid through the Philippines' Green Energy Auction Program. This is the largest internationally funded solar project in the country, supporting the Philippines' renewable energy goals and contributing to TotalEnergies' broader 9 GW renewable portfolio in Asia.
